#34b42f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34b42f is composed of 20.4% red, 70.6%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 117.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 44.5%. #34b42f color hex could be obtained by blending #68ff5e with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#34b42f color description : Moderate lime green.
#34b42f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34b42f has RGB values of R:52, G:180,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 3453999.

Shades and Tints of #34b42f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030902 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#34b42f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d776c is the less saturated color, while #0ce003 is the most saturated one.
